If you can help us with Godfrey, please Contact Us. Godfrey would have been located within present day Stevens County<2>. The location of Godfrey has been provided by the Geographic Names Information System (ie- the GNIS).<3> While we don't have a date for the founding of Godfrey, you might consider that their post office opened in 1905. While the community is gone, the present day location for Godfrey is 1,440 feet [439 m] above sea level.<4>. Time Zone: The area where Godfrey was located is in the Pacific Time Zone (PST/PDT) and observes daylight saving time The location where Godfrey once stood is in the (509) area code.
